Thyroglossal duct cysts (TDC) are the
most common congenital neck cysts and malignancy can be seen in 1% of the
cases. The most common malignant pathology of the thyroid is papillary
carcinoma. Pathological examination is necessary for diagnosis and planning of
the treatment. In this study, we reported a 42-year-old male patient who has a
17x15 mm diameter TDC in the midline and he was treated with transcervical
excision after US-guided fine needle aspiration biopsy (FNAB) from the solid
lesion.
